China’s embattled HNA Group is planning to break new ground in Australian maritime law with a suit for wrongful arrest against former client Shagang Shipping.

Legal experts say there is technically no such thing as a wrongful arrest action under Australian maritime law but nothing to prevent such a lawsuit, either.

TradeWinds understands that HNA officials are keen to try it as a method to discourage its Nemesis, Shagang, from continuing a series of arrests, attachments and other actions.
